    While I like the dishwasher a great deal there are little things about it that nag at me. They really only disappoint because it could have been so much better. My comments are after only having the unit about a month. I really can't speak to reliability yet. Here is a quick list of the good and bad: Good - Nearly silent - Most of the time I can't tell if it is running Good - Simple controls (almost too simple - see BAD below) Good - Third rack is handier than I'd have thought (wish height adjusted) Good - the tines are VERY adjustable with lots of options to change Good - Installation was relatively simple (one exception) Good - Seems to clean very well so far Bad - Controls are TOO simple - buttons have multiple options and I'd rather have had a few more buttons with less combinations to control Bad - Doesn't remember last cycle or your preferred settings and requires you to constantly change settings to get it right each time (HATE HATE THIS) - my previous dishwasher was over 7 years old and had this down perfectly - what happened to progress? Bad - Racks are sticky and don't glide in and out. Ironically I loved this about the floor demo I saw as it worked perfectly but I find the racks could go in and out easier Bad - Adjustment for leveling during install is incredibly cool but a bit of a pain to operate and almost didn't work at all when I first got it. Looks easy to break. Bad - No light to tell you if your dishes are clean after it finishes running. This baffles me. There are lights and an LCD - why couldn't they use this to tell me if the dish washer is done washing and clean?? BIG PET PEAVE HERE. Again, my 7 year old previous dishwasher did this why not this one? Bad - The middle rack seems to always need help getting pushed in all the way. Presumably this is because the spray nozzle for the second rack has to seat into the back of the washer to connect into the water source but I always feel like I have to force the dishwasher closed because the second rack isn't in all the way. Bad - The mechanism that closes and holds the detergent is a major pain in the neck. It never closes the first time. Frankly, it is just poorly designed. If it remembered the last wash cycle and the holder for the detergent worked right I'd rate it 5 stars. The lack of a wash finished/clean light at the end of a cleaning cycle is unforgivable. My kids are constantly putting dirty dishes into a clean dishwasher or not realizing the dishes are done.

    This LG 24 Inch Dish Washer is a very quite machine. It also cleans very well. But there are two major problems with the design. First and most important is the that main dish rack keeps falling off the its holding rails. When rack is nearly full of dishes and you pull out the rack to place the last few dishes in, the rack falls of the its rails and the dishes bang together. You have to remove most, if not all the dishes, reset the dish rack and then reload the dishes back into the washer. When the dish rack falls off of its track, the dishes can chip. Be extra careful is you have fine china. The second problems is the soap dispenser which is to small for the new tablet size dish washer packs. Oven it takes two or three tries to get the lit to close. One other problem is the simple lack of air dry. Oven the dishes come out wet and need to be hand wiped.

    Within the first year of owning this dishwasher we had to have the entire pumping system replaced. When the repair man came out because we called because it was making so much noise he couldn't figure out was wrong with it so he just replace the entire pumping system. We are now almost 3 years into owning this dishwasher and have yet another error code where the water will not drain out. So now we are out in search of a new pump and hose which no one in our area carries, to see if we can fix it ourselves before calling a repair man because we are now out of warranty. As others have mentioned some other issues with this dishwasher are the bottom rack comes off the track and when it's full of dishes it's hard to get it back in. it also runs for a very long time even on the shortest cycle so I feel that it uses a lot of water, the water bill has gone up since we purchased the diswasher not a great deal but enough to notice. When it is running it does run quietly and it does clean the dishes nicely. It also is hard to load with the spindles that go up and down it sometimes is hard to figure out how to get the dishes to stay upright. All in all if I had to buy it again and I knew what I know now I would avoid this dishwasher we may have received a lemon I'm not sure but having to fix the dishwasher twice within a three-year period after it's brand-new is unacceptable. It's quite an expensive dishwasher to have this many problems I had a GE in my home when I first built it and it lasted for 10 years before I replaced it with this LG. And I take my GE back right now just so I didn't have to hand wash my dishes.

    We did a lot of research before buying this both on line and in person. We compared it to Kitchen Aid and Bosch in our research. All three brands are very nice. They look good and have pretty much the same washing features. The Kitchen Aid cost 30% more; the Bosch reviews said the service was bad. Bosch also had a one year warranty. The LG has a two year warranty on parts and labor, and five years on electronics, 10 years on the motor, and lifetime on the stainless interior. None other compared on warranty. We also bought the Geek Squad warranty for trouble free service going forward. This dishwasher is super quiet, the controls are easy to use if you read the book, and it really is a very attractive appliance in our kitchen which has other stainless appliances. There are two things we needed to adjust to compared to the Kenmore this LG replaced. As someone else mentioned, the bottom rack comes off the track if you pull it all the way out for loading. It's actually hit or miss, but mostly miss, if the dishes are not placed on the rack in a balanced way. It's bad engineering, plain and simple. If the rack is almost full of dishes it will be difficult to get it back on the track, as heavy lifting would be necessary. We were used to the Kenmore which was ten years old, and which took a lot of use and very little abuse. Once we start loading it more regularly, I'm sure we will figure it out and it will be less annoying. The controls are sensitive. My wife and I each touched the power key accidentally while getting something out of a cupboard. The unit played a little tune to remind us it was on. It does shut itself off four minutes later. It has some nice features. It has a third tray for silverware or small items which is minimally useful. It does, however, expand what the dishwasher will hold. We use it for spatulas, larger knives and small plastics. We are still practicing how to load it. It does have a long cycle, but it's so quiet, who cares. It's rated at $31 a YEAR to run, with average use. The dishes came out dry and sparkling clean. A few plastic items and glasses puddled on top, but that's normal for all dishwashers. A great unit, would recommend. We bought it on sale, and the salesperson at Best Buy was very helpful and extremely knowledgeable. When we get used to loading that bottom rack, it will have been a perfect purchase.
